From the lyrics and reading the CD booklet, I think this song is about how Jesus saved mankind and mankind crucified Him (and has been recrucifying him over and over ever since then). Some see the wrong they have done and turn towards Jesus, realizing that His words are truth and that He truly loves them. The cycle (circle) of people crucifying/forsaking Jesus and then turning to, and believing in, Him continues through time.
